WebDew point relates to non-pressurized, atmospheric air (atmospheric dew point). Pressure dew point is referred to when measuring the dew point temperature of gases at pressures higher than atmospheric pressure. Dew point temperatures in compressed air range from ambient down to -80°C (-112°F) in special cases.
